Crossing Guard Joe, released in 2022, is an engaging action-casual simulation game set in the bustling world of Monoxide City. Players step into the shoes of Joe, a dedicated crossing guard tasked with helping children safely navigate the chaotic streets filled with relentless traffic. This unique premise combines fun gameplay with an important message about safety, setting it apart from other titles in its genre.
When it comes to PC performance, Crossing Guard Joe is quite accessible, requiring only an entry-level GPU with a minimum score of around 300. Players can expect smooth gameplay and decent frames per second (FPS) on a range of mid-tier hardware, including budget options, making it an excellent choice for casual gamers. With only 4 GB of RAM required, even older systems can handle this title with the right graphics settings, ensuring an enjoyable experience without demanding high-end equipment.
